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Sarina Ramirez made an unannounced visit to the facility to conduct a required annual inspection. LPA met with Adminstrator Restituto Calilung, and discussed the purpose of the visit. The facility is a Residential Care Facility for the Elderly (RCFE) with a license capacity of (6), a current census of (5) residents in care and a hospice waiver for (6). LPA Ramirez conducted an overall inspection of the facility, which included, but was not limited to, the following: Physical Plant/Environment: Indoor and outdoor passageways are free of obstruction. The facility has a swimming pool gated and locked inaccessible to residents in care. Outdoor shaded area is sufficient for resident activities and is enclosed with self-latching gate. The facility has sufficient lighting and is maintained at a comfortable temperature. The facility has operating carbon monoxide alarms and telephone service. Resident’s showers, toilets, and hand washing areas were operating in a safe and sanitary conditions. The hot water temperature in thee (3) resident bathrooms measured 105,106, and 108 degrees F. Five (5) resident’s bedrooms had beds, bed linen, chairs, storage space and sufficient lighting. The facility has sufficient linens, towels, and personal hygiene items for residents. The facility has posted in a common area, complaint poster, Ombudsman poster, facility license, disaster evacuation plan, emergency telephone numbers, food menu, and activities. Food Service: Facility kitchen and dining areas are maintained clean. The facility has sufficient non-perishable and perishable food supply for residents in care. Sharps were kept unlocked and accessible to residents in care, technical violation cited. Continuation on LIC – 809C: Care & Supervision : Facility has 24-hour/7days a week care staff. Facility staff have current CPR/first aid training. Medical Related Services : Resident’s medications are labeled and centrally stored in a locked cabinet, Technical Assistance issued. The facility has sufficient first aid supplies. Record Review: The Administrator's certification is current. The facility’s last fire drill was conducted on 4/2/24, and last earthquake drill was conducted on 7/2/24. Three (3) Staff files reviewed were observed to be complete. Three (3) Resident files reviewed were observed to be complete. Based on observations and record review, technical violation and technical assistance will be issued per Title 22, of The California Code of Regulations. An exit interview was conducted where the Licensing reports were discussed and copies with appeal rights were provided to Adminstrator Restituto Calilung.
